The ratio of cost price to the marked price of an
article is 5:8. The article had been marked above its cost price by Rs. 360. If the article was sold at a discount of Rs. 180, then find the profit/loss percentage incurred.Solution
Let the cost price and marked price of the article be Rs. 5x and Rs. 8x, respectively
According to the question,
8x β 5x = 360
Or, x = 120
Therefore, cost price of the article = 5x = Rs. 600
Marked price of the article = 8x = Rs. 960
Selling price of the article = 960 β 180 = Rs. 780
Required profit percentage = {(780 β 600)/600} Γ 100 = 30%
